I hope you like what I’ve put together for your offices.
I found desk furniture that still has the traditional lines of what you currently have, but the lighter wood tone feels a little bit more updated. Instead of trying to match all the wood tones I picked black as an accent (the file cabinet or bookshelves) and then I also picked a larger bookshelf that’s black metal. I think the black tones will help it look a lot more modern without adding to the contending wood tones. I picked some furniture for the head pastor‘s office. But these are examples of things that you can repeat in other places. Repeating elements and colors will help it feel more uniform.
For the library I picked a sofa and some matching chairs and then brought in black for the coffee table.
If you do buy any rugs, be really careful to not buy any that are too small. They immediately make the space feel smaller and broken up. I really wouldn’t put anything smaller than a 9 x 12 in any of the rooms I’m working on. Maybe an 8×10 if you put one in one of the closed off offices.
